| seneca |
| quote: | Originally posted by darin epsilon
Did Seneca switch to NI Traktor? |
you are correct sir...
I previously had Final Scratch 2.0 before Serato. I also used Traktor DJ Studio 2.6 with the Final Scratch System which was sweet.
Then when I bought the Intel MacBook, I waited patiently for an update b/c it wasn't compatible. And waited... and waited. Eventually Stanton and NI said that they were splitting ways and everyone who had a new Intel Mac was screwed. So I promptly sold it and purchased Serato Scratch Live.
Now I'm back to square one b/c they offered users of Serato or Traktor DJ Studio the system for $399 instead of $599 if you bought it in the first month of the release. |

| seneca |
what would be sweet is if the Clubs invested in "part" of the setups so that they are already there and ready for digital DJs.
take a look at the cables for Traktor. The first set has a splitter that can be plugged in WITHOUT the audio interface attached which is unlike Serato. This means the club can have that cable hooked up for the DJs before the digital DJ and play no problem. Once the digital DJ shows up, all the have to do is hook up the second set of cables to the XLR connection on each cable and you are done.
I can't wait until that day. |
